La corónica is a refereed journal published by the MLA Forum LLC Medieval Iberian. Devoted to Hispanomedievalism in its broadest sense, La corónica welcomes scholarship that transcends the linguistic and/or cultural borders of Spanish and explores the interconnectedness of those regions.

Indexing

La corónica is indexed in the following databases:

Project MUSE (vols. 29 until present available)

Modern Languages Association bibliography

Iter: Gateway to the Middle Ages and Renaissance

Dialnet

Boletín Bibliográfico de la AHLM (Asociación Hispánica de Literatura Medieval)

International Medieval Bibliography, Leeds.

OCLC ArticleFirst
